Output 2ca1f5bf8db8dcf095bb3dc358b0a7bb5e7860e44bd9fcd39e2241db6323f888:1

value
348821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3505fe26586c21e2287934f6d4de64ae0534421f OP_EQUAL
address
2Mx5ayqSuk5TW7v9W51KwrvxTH1vDEtpp6p
transaction
2ca1f5bf8db8dcf095bb3dc358b0a7bb5e7860e44bd9fcd39e2241db6323f888
confirmations
109658
spent
true